[PATCH] perf sched timehist: Skip print non-idle task samples when only show idle events
Posted by Yang Jihong 1 year, 4 months ago
when only show idle events, runtime stats of non-idle tasks is not updated,
and the value is 0, there is no need to print non-idle samples.

Fixes: 07235f84ece6 ("perf sched timehist: Add -I/--idle-hist option")
Signed-off-by: Yang Jihong <yangjihong@bytedance.com>
---
 tools/perf/builtin-sched.c | 8 +++++++-
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/tools/perf/builtin-sched.c b/tools/perf/builtin-sched.c
index 8750b5f2d49b..04770c2ae008 100644
--- a/tools/perf/builtin-sched.c
+++ b/tools/perf/builtin-sched.c
@@ -2729,8 +2729,14 @@ static int timehist_sched_change_event(struct perf_tool *tool,
 		}
 	}
 
-	if (!sched->summary_only)
+	/*
+	 * when only show idle events, only runtime stats of idle tasks
+	 * need to update, and can skip non-idle tasks sample.
+	 */
+	if (!sched->summary_only &&
+	    !(sched->idle_hist && thread__tid(thread) != 0)) {
 		timehist_print_sample(sched, evsel, sample, &al, thread, t, state);
+	}
 
 out:
 	if (sched->hist_time.start == 0 && t >= ptime->start)
